What is an electric scooter?
The scooters you’re probably familiar with require you to push with your right or left leg to get faster, right?
Well, this is no longer necessary, children’s electric scooter Speeds up to 20 km/h make life easier for your kids, it makes riding around you a breeze, and the battery only takes 3-4 hours to charge, but can give you 20 km of fun.
